This is the Bethlehem Lutheran Church, corner of Gomersal and Heinrich Rd, Gomersal. Gomersal was formerly named Schoenborn (beautiful spring) by the Lutheran settlers to the region in 1849. The township was renamed Gomersal in 1918. This church was opened in 1926. Located in the Barossa Valley, South Australia.
